Subject: Handover — Glazemap tile cache

Hi Ondra,

Taking over on-call for the Glazemap tile-rendering cache layer tonight. Eviction runs hourly; if hit rate drops below 80%, warm the cache via the prewarm job before paging anyone. Rollbacks must be signed, and the rotation happened Tuesday, so discard anything older. The current signing key is as follows:

release key, yagap-kagag: bky6_1ks93y

Internal Memo — Headcount Plan

To all branch managers: Next year's headcount plan is now fixed. Net growth is limited to the Dunmere and Ashvale branches. All other branches hold flat; backfills require regional sign-off. Submit staffing variance requests by the 15th. Do not circulate beyond your management team. The confidential planning note appears below.

confidential, bahap-bajog: Zorethix Works is in early talks to buy Kelethox Foods for about $30.7 million. The Ralvan launch date is September 19, and nothing goes to the press before then.

## Configuration

Welcome to Fernkit, our shared component library. Versioning is automated: the release bot bumps semver based on commit prefixes, so don't hand-edit the version field — it'll just get clobbered. Locally you only need one env file to publish preview builds to the internal registry. Everything else has sane defaults. The registry publish credential goes on the line right after this one.

secret setting of yajog-taguf: ARCHIVE_KEY3=051

Subject: Pinoak build cut-over — done!

Hi support folks,

Quick recap: as of this morning, Pinoak builds run entirely on the hermetic Kilnworks system. No more "works on my machine" tickets, in theory — every build pulls pinned toolchains and runs in isolation. If customers report version mismatches, first check the build stamp in the About dialog; anything older than today predates the cut-over. The settings the new builder runs with are as follows.

service settings:
PRAWYN_PIN=9848
PRAWYN_METRICS_HOST=metrics.prawyn.lumicworks.corp
PRAWYN_LOG_LEVEL=warn
PRAWYN_TENANT=pelius